I’ve been using FreePBX for about a week now and it is perfect. However, I have this question and I hope someone here can help me with this one. I’ve been tinkering with caller ID lookup source and as far as I know this is only usable for inbound routes. My question is, Is it possible to use Caller ID lookup sources for extension to extension use? For example, I have fixed extension numbers ex. 100, 101, 102 etc, But the username linked to these extensions might change from time to time, Im planning to use a MYSQL database for the lookup sources but for internal calls only. Is this even possible?

Why not change the name on the extension? I think that’s the right way to do it.


Im planning to develop a simple VB6 application that can connect thru mysql Database and change the name on the extension without logging into the the freepbx GUI

Nope - that won’t be sufficient. You will need to update the ASTDB and the MySQL database for this to have any hope of working, and even then the likelihood is that there are going to be more steps that you need to undertake.

Why wouldn’t you set the name in the Endpoint configuration page? You’re making this harder than it has to be. If you’re flipping users too fast to bother the 45 seconds or so it takes to rename an extension, maybe you could assign the user name by role or location or something else that tells you what ext. is calling that wouldn’t change frequently (e.g. “Kitchen” or “Shop” or whatever)?

If your endpoints aren’t Polycom SP IP550’s the phone will display what FreePBX sends it. If they are IP550s or IP335s, browse to the phones IP address & go to Utilities->Line Key Configuration where anything you list will override whatever FreePBX sends you. (Tip: blank out this list & let FreePBX do the heavy lifting – it’s infinitely easier to manage!)

